The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, Engineer Research and Development Center (ERDC) Geotechnical and Structures Laboratory (GSL), Structural Mechanics Branch (SMB) intends to award a sole source basis in accordance RFO FAR 13.101(b) to Stumptown Research & Development LLC, 104 Eastside Drive, Suite 110, Black Mountain, NC 28711-8208, as the sole manufacturer and only responsible source that can provide a 8-ft x 8-ft Blast Load Simulator (BLS-8). This acquisition is being conducted under RFO FAR Part 13, Simplified Procedures for Noncommercial Acquisitions. The Structural Mechanics Branch (SMB) of the Geotechnical and Structures Laboratory (GSL) of the US Army Engineer Research and Development Center (ERDC) currently conducts R&D by operating an 8-ft x 8-ft Blast Load Simulator (BLS-8) and an Advanced Blast Simulator (ABLS-12) that are used to evaluate structural targets subjected to shock waves produced by either compressed or combustible gasses. Items included in this acquisition are: One (1) combustible Gas System Flow Controller for the BLS-8. The Stumptown Research and Development, LLC Compressed Gas Driven Simulator must include: the ability to adhere to the same specifications as the existing combustible BLS Gas System Flow Controller. The components must consist of one main Valve Rack and one Driver Valve Rack. The main Valve Rack must house the flow controllers, flame arresters, driver isolation valves, and the driver. The Driver valve rack must house the spring return isolation valves, venturi evacuation pump, and electric match connection. The gas delivery system must be controlled with a provided Control Unit, which is equipped with an Emergency Shut Off (E-Stop) switch and performs multiple operations simultaneously. The intended procurement will be classified under North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) 333998 - All Other Miscellaneous General Purpose Machinery Manufacturing, with a size standard of 700 employees.
